Need Help With Picking Out A EVO IX

Hello, I was wondering which 06 Evolution IX would be the most reliable, best in performance, and will last me the longest with out breaking down... im a little bit in the noob section on Mitsubishi...The 06 EVO IX MR edition (6 speed) or the 06 EVO IX SE (5 speed)?? I have heard that the MR edition does not accelerate as fast as the SE and it has more turbo lag. I dont know if thats true so i want YOU evo ix mr and evo ix se owners to tell me the truth about that. any help would be appreciated
